What Problem Does This Solve?

Implementing IDP in logistics presents unique challenges that often derail DIY attempts. Many organizations struggle with inaccurate data extraction from highly variable documents like international shipping invoices or goods receipt notes, leading to errors in inventory or customs declarations. Building a robust system requires deep expertise in optical character recognition (OCR) refinement, natural language processing (NLP) model training, and integration complexities. Common pitfalls include underestimating the data volume, failing to account for diverse document formats across various carriers and countries, and neglecting the continuous maintenance required for AI models. Without a structured approach, internal teams often face issues with scalability, struggling to process peak document loads or integrate directly with legacy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) or Transport Management Systems (TMS). These hurdles result in delayed shipments, compliance risks, and wasted resources, ultimately undermining the very efficiency gains IDP promises.

How Would Syntora Approach This?

Our methodology for Intelligent Document Processing in logistics follows a proven build strategy, leveraging best-in-class technologies and custom tooling. We start with a comprehensive data audit and document schema design, identifying critical data points for extraction across all document types. The core of our solution is built using Python, chosen for its robust ecosystem of AI and data processing libraries. For advanced natural language understanding and adaptive OCR, we integrate with modern large language models like the Claude API, allowing us to handle diverse document layouts and complex language nuances found in logistics documents. Data storage and API management are handled by Supabase, providing a scalable and secure backend for extracted information. Custom tooling is developed to orchestrate the entire workflow, from document ingestion via various channels (email, SFTP, APIs) to data validation, transformation, and final delivery into your existing systems. This integrated approach ensures high accuracy, reliability, and seamless data flow, delivering a tailor-made IDP solution that evolves with your operational needs.

How does IDP integrate with our existing ERP, TMS, or WMS systems?
We ensure seamless integration using various methods. This includes robust API connectors, webhooks for real-time data push, and custom adaptors for legacy systems. Our solutions are designed to feed extracted and validated data directly into your existing platforms like SAP, Oracle, or other industry-specific software.
